Glad you are enjoying the ZS EV. My Hypervolt installation cost £580. That was for full installation with no additional electrical work. It was also for a charger with a 5m cable but somehow I ended up with a 7.5m one at no additional cost.

Just finished charging my car at home. I left it unlocked and plugged in the charger. Charging started and the car was unlocked the whole time. To finish I locked the car then unlocked it using the key fob. I was then able to release the cable.
I use Tesco PodPoint chargers on a regular basis. I have to say that I have never had a problem. To stop the charger I just lock the car, because I am usually sitting in it then unlock the car - using the key for both operations.
I used a 150kw charger today at MFG Crow Orchard near Wigan. I wondered why the cable was so big and heavy. Luckily it was relatively simple for me to plug in. Not so for the IPace 2 bays down who had to drive in at an angle and take up 2 bays in order to connect his cable.
I did a trip from a Sheffield to Wigan today Via A57. I started off in KERS 3 and then moved to KERS 2 whilst I was going through the Snake Pass. Back to KERS 3 going through Glossop and then KERS 1 on the M60 before going back to KERS 3 once I had left the motorway.
